To change a headlight on an 08 plate astra, you need to go in through the wheel arch with the streering lock full on.
There's enough space behind each unit to be able to change the bulb without resorting to removing the unit itself.

Pop the bonnet up, then look at the back of the headlight it should be a grey plastic plug on the outside edge of the headlight, this will pull out quite easily, if not give it a twist, push in and twist existing bulb to release, then replace bulb, then put plug back in.
